摘要
目的:研究siRNA干扰β-catenin对人骨肉瘤U2OS细胞增殖能力的影响。方法:利用脂质体Lipofectamine 2000将靶向β-catenin的siRNA转染人骨肉瘤U2OS细胞,Western blot技术检测β-catenin基因沉默效果。分别采用CCK-8法和流式细胞学技术检测细胞增殖和周期,Western blot检测cyclin D1的蛋白表达。结果:siRNA干扰有效阻断了人骨肉瘤U2OS细胞的β-catenin表达。β-catenin siRNA转染U2OS细胞48h、72h后,与空白组和阴性对照组相比,细胞增殖能力显著下降,细胞周期明显阻滞于G0/G1期,细胞中cyclin D1蛋白表达水平明显下降(P<0.05)。结论:特异性抑制β-catenin基因表达可抑制人骨肉瘤U2OS细胞增殖。
Objective :To investigate the effect ofβ -catenin silence by siRNA interference on the proliferation of human osteosarcoma cell U20S. Methods :The β -eatenin -siRNA was transfected into U20S cells with Lipofectami- neTM 2000. Theβ- catenin expression was detected by Western blot after transfection to investigate the silence effect. Cell cycle was detected by flow cytometry, cell proliferation was assayed by CCK -8 assay and the protein expression of cyclin D1 was detected by Western blot. Results : siRNA interference effectively block the expression of β - catenin in human osteosarcoma cell U20S. The cell proliferation was obviously decreased. Cell cycle analysis presented obvi- ous G0o/G1 blockage and the expression of cyclin D1 protein was significantly decreased in U2OS cells transfected withβ- catenin siRNA for 48h and 72h ( P 〈 0.05 ). Conclusion: Specific blockage of β- catenin expression inhibited the proliferation of human osteosarcoma cell U2OS.
